Shouldn't be hard to live anywhere for 3k if you play your cards right and rent a studio apartment for 1k or less. A few things are coming up you might want to consider.

For partying:
You have the carnival in Rio in February
and also the Carnival of Barranquilla in February.
Apartments will run you 1k-1.5k. Quilla may be slightly less.

For relaxing and settling down with a few women:
Cali, Colombia
Apartment will run you $500

For partying, women, and hanging with forum members
Bogota, Colombia
Apartment will run you $750
